AI and Smart Home technologies see key updates in week 33

Technological developments in week 33 highlight the integration of artificial intelligence into daily consumer tasks and smart home ecosystems. OpenAI is gradually rolling out ChatGPT map features to users within the European Union, enabling more location-based queries regarding routes and local contexts.

In the smart home sector, FRITZ!OS 8.50 introduces a Matter bridge for specific models like the FRITZ!Box 5690 Pro, facilitating connectivity between Matter-enabled devices and various smart home environments. Additionally, Telekom is offering ‘Call Connect via Funk’ as a mobile alternative for traditional landline connections.

Artificial intelligence is also increasingly utilized for travel planning. Tools such as ChatGPT, Gemini, and Copilot assist users in generating itineraries, packing lists, and restaurant recommendations based on specific budgets and interests. However, experts advise that AI should be used for initial inspiration rather than a total replacement for independent research.
